Daily Progress readers recently received an uplifting, tear-jerking story of the UVA student who suffered what might have been a fatal, face-crushing injury while bicycling the Blue Ridge Parkway. Were it not for some doctors, including Martha Jefferson’s well-placed Mark Harris and UVA’s Stephen Park, there might have been a vastly different ending to this three-part story.
